#3cb007 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3cb007 is composed of 23.5% red, 69%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 96%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 101.2 degrees, a saturation of 92.3% and a lightness of 35.9%. #3cb007 color hex could be obtained by blending #78ff0e with #006100.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#3cb007 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3cb007 has RGB values of R:60, G:176,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 3977223.

Shades and Tints of #3cb007
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020600 is the darkest color, while #f6fef2 is the lightest one.
